The 37-year-old actress began her career at 15, modelling across Europe. Throughout her modelling career she appeared in campaigns for brands including Peroni beer and for the long-standing German mail-order catalogue Quelle.

Despite finding success as a model in Europe, Japan and South Africa, Ghenea had aspirations beyond the runaway and so began pursuing a career in acting. In 2011 she starred in her first film, Italian comedy I soliti idioti: Il film (The Usual Idiots: The Film).

Since then she’s been taking on roles steadily. As a polyglot fluent in Romanian, Italian, Spanish and English, she has acted in English and Italian films. In 2013 she starred alongside English actor Jude Law in the crime comedy Dom Hemingway. She also had a small part in Ben Stiller’s comedy Zoolander 2 in 2016.

Ghenea’s most notable role came in 2021 when she was cast in Ridley Scott’s biographical depiction of the Gucci family, House of Gucci. She appeared as Italian film icon Sophia Loren alongside an ensemble cast that included Lady Gaga, Adam Driver, Jared Leto, Al Pacino and Salma Hayek.

She followed that up with a leading role in the film Deep Fear. In the 2023 thriller she plays Naomi, a solo sailor forced to retrieve drugs from shark-heavy waters. Gossip Girl actor Ed Westwick also stars in the film.
